My First Vision Board

My vision board is a collection of images, words, and symbols that reflect the kind of life I want to build for myself in the future. It focuses on four important areas: health, education, relationships, and happiness. Each section shows my dreams, goals, and the things that truly matter to me.

First, for the area of health, I included pictures of healthy meals, like fruits and vegetables, and a person jogging along a path in nature. I believe that taking care of my body is the first step to living a balanced and energetic life. Good health allows me to stay active, feel more confident, and avoid stress. I also added a yoga pose and a water bottle to remind myself to stay hydrated and mentally calm. Staying healthy isn’t just about how I look—it’s also about how I feel inside and out. My vision board helps me remember that making small daily choices like exercising or eating well can have a big impact over time.

Second, when it comes to education, I filled that section of my board with inspiring images such as books, a graduation cap, a diploma, and even a person studying at a desk. These symbols remind me of how much I value learning and personal growth. I want to do well in school not just to get good grades, but because I enjoy learning new ideas and solving problems. My dream is to go to a great university one day and study something I’m passionate about, like science or art. I also believe that education opens doors to opportunities I can’t even imagine yet. This part of my vision board motivates me to stay focused, curious, and never give up, even when things get hard.

Third, the relationships section is full of warmth and connection. I included pictures of friends laughing together, families hugging, and people helping each other, because relationships are the heart of life. I want to build stronger friendships, be closer with my family, and be a person others can trust and count on. Having good people around me makes everything better—whether I’m going through challenges or celebrating success. My board reminds me to be kind, listen more, and make time for the people who matter most. One of my goals is to learn how to be a better communicator and to show appreciation to those I care about.

Fourth and finally, for happiness, I chose pictures that make me smile just by looking at them. I added scenes of people traveling, doing creative hobbies like painting and music, and most exciting of all, a vibrant amusement park filled with rides, lights, and laughter. That image stands out the most, because it reminds me that life should also be fun. I want to enjoy moments, explore new places, and make memories that I’ll treasure forever. Happiness isn’t just a goal—it’s a way of living every day with joy, gratitude, and excitement. This section helps me remember not to take life too seriously and to always make space for fun, laughter, and adventure.

In conclusion, my vision board is more than just a school project—it’s a picture of the future I hope to create. Each area—health, education, relationships, and happiness—shows me what I want to focus on as I grow. Whenever I look at it, I feel inspired and reminded of my goals. It helps me stay hopeful, motivated, and excited about the journey ahead.
